Monday, January 22nd, 2018 | 8:00 a.m. – 12:00 p.m.

In today’s ever-changing business world, risk is an inherent component that must be accounted for. In this session you will learn how to identify the general categories and events that most adversely affect businesses and the benefits of developing an effective overall risk mitigation strategy.  In addition, you will be introduced to the concepts of Risk-Based Thinking, as well as the basic principles of risk identification, risk management, risk analysis, and risk control and mitigation.  This activity-based session will include group exercises and discussion.

Program Objectives:
– Learn elements of risk management that affect all companies.
– Learn how these risk management principles relate to ISO9001:2015, ISO14001:2015, IATF16949:2016, ISO13485:2016, and AS9100D.

Intended audience: Team members with responsibilities in the following areas:
– Risk management
– ISO 9001:2015, ISO14001:2015, IATF16949:2016, ISO13485:2016, and AS9100D
– Procurement and logistics
– Managing overall company risk
